Removal & Installation (2.2L)

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2002 Pontiac Grand Am, 2002 Oldsmobile Alero, and 2002 Chevrolet Malibu.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

Knock sensor is located on side of cylinder block. See Fig 1 . Turn ignition off. Disconnect negative battery cable. Raise and support vehicle. Disconnect starter wiring harness connectors. Remove starter bolts and starter. Disconnect knock sensor electrical connector. Remove knock sensor. To install, reverse removal procedure. Tighten knock sensor to specification.
